President Lee Jae-myung's approval rating stands at 43.8%, according to a recent public opinion poll.


On July 8, Cookie News commissioned Hankyoreh Research to survey 1,004 adults aged 18 and older nationwide from July 4 to 6. The results showed that 53.0% of respondents disapproved of the president's performance, while 43.8% approved. Additionally, 3.1% of respondents were unsure.


Regionally, the highest disapproval rating was recorded in Incheon and Gyeonggi Province at 57.5%, followed by Seoul at 55.2%. Daegu and North Gyeongsang Province reported a disapproval rate of 60.8%, the highest in the country. Busan, Ulsan, and South Gyeongsang Province also had a disapproval rate of 53.8%, above the national average. In contrast, the Honam region showed a positive approval rating of 67.5%.


By political party, the Democratic Party garnered 39.2% support, while the People Power Party received 25.3%, resulting in a gap of 13.9 percentage points between the two parties. The Justice Reform Party received 4.4%, other parties 4.1%, the Reform Party 2.8%, and the Progressive Party 2.2%. Meanwhile, 19.3% of respondents indicated they did not support any party, and 2.7% were unsure, leading to a total of 22.0% of undecided voters.


The survey was conducted using 1.4% landline interviews and 98.6% mobile ARS. The margin of error is ±3.1 percentage points at a 95% confidence level, with a response rate of 1.4%. For more details, please refer to the Central Election Survey Deliberation Commission's website.
